Biography of Al Bundy

Al Bundy, portrayed by actor Ed O'Neill, first appeared on television screens in the pilot episode of "Married... with Children" on April 5, 1987. Al is characterized as a disgruntled shoe salesman living in Chicago with his dysfunctional family. He is married to Peggy Bundy, played by Katey Sagal, and they have two children: Kelly and Bud. The show quickly became a staple of American sitcoms, often depicting the struggles of middle-class life in a humorous yet relatable way.

Character Traits

Al Bundy is known for several distinctive traits that define his character throughout the series. Understanding these traits can help us appreciate the humor and relatability of his character.

  • Discontentment: Al often expresses dissatisfaction with his life, particularly his job and family responsibilities.
  • Wit and Sarcasm: Al is famous for his quick wit and sarcastic remarks, which often serve as comedic relief.
  • Reluctant Hero: Despite his grumpy demeanor, Al shows moments of kindness and love for his family, especially in times of need.
  • Everyman Persona: Al represents the struggles of the average American man, making his character relatable to many viewers.

Cultural Significance of Al Bundy

Al Bundy has become a cultural icon, representing the challenges faced by the modern American family. The show "Married... with Children" challenged traditional sitcom norms by presenting a more cynical view of family life.

Al’s character has been analyzed in various studies, highlighting his role in advancing discourse on gender roles, family dynamics, and societal expectations. His often exaggerated reactions to everyday situations reflect the frustrations many individuals experience in their own lives.

Impact on Television and Comedy

The impact of Al Bundy on television and comedy is profound. "Married... with Children" paved the way for a new style of sitcom that focused on realism and dark humor, influencing numerous shows that followed.

The series broke ground by embracing themes that other shows typically avoided, such as financial struggles and marital discontent. This shift in narrative style opened the door for more complex character development in sitcoms.
